Great escapes: Your ultimate isolation entertainment itinerary

With international travel off the cards for the immediate future you can still escape boredom — and explore the rest of the world remotely — with these classic and new films, television shows, podcasts and books.

Despite not being able to travel further than the backyard, we can still expand our horizons without leaving the sofa.

From a spin around Rome on a scooter, Audrey Hepburn-style, to a beach adventure in Thailand like Leonardo DiCaprio, or a trip to Corfu with the Durrells, here’s how to plot your great escape with our pick of movies, TV shows, books, audiobooks and podcasts.

MOVIES

MURDER ON THE ORIENT EXPRESS The murder part notwithstanding, get on board for the most glamorous train trip through Europe, whether you catch the Albert Finney, Kenneth Branagh or Alfred Molina version.

THE TALENTED MR RIPLEY Jude Law in white trunks is the best advert for Italy’s Ischia we’ve ever seen.

CRAZY RICH ASIANS Live the high-life, virtually, as part of the Singapore rich list.

ROMAN HOLIDAY Who wouldn’t want to see Rome on a scooter with Gregory Peck?

INTO THE WILD This moving true story is for everyone who ever fantasised about packing it all in and escaping to Alaska.

A ROOM WITH A VIEW An oldie, but one of the most atmospheric depictions of Florence ever made. Don’t bring your guide book.

MAMMA MIA! You don’t need a wedding invite to head to the Greek island of Skopelos – or for Mamma Mia 2, Croatia, masquerading as Greece.

EASY RIDER Join Peter Fonda and Dennis Hopper on the ultimate road trip through America’s south.

THE ADVENTURES OF PRISCILLA, QUEEN OF THE DESERT Glam it up for the best-ever Aussie road trip across the outback.

MIDNIGHT IN PARIS Journey to Paris and back in time in this quirky Woody Allen movie.

IN BRUGES This hitman comedy doubles as a high-speed tour of the Belgian city.

THE DARJEELING Limited Take a trip across India in this chaotic Wes Anderson comedy.

THE WORLD IS NOT ENOUGH Take your pick of James Bond movies for a tour of the world’s most glamorous locations, but for a thrilling boat ride down the Thames in London, pick Pierce Brosnan.

HARRY POTTER And for more magical trips around Britain, catch the train to Hogwarts which in real life is the Jacobite steam train in Scotland.

CALL ME BY YOUR NAME Spend a summer in Italy with this recent Oscar-winning movie, or similarly 1996’s Stealing Beauty with Liv Tyler.

LOVE WEDDING REPEAT Can’t fly to Rome? The spectacular opening scene of this engaging new Netflix rom-com is the next best thing to a window seat.

WITHNAIL AND I And if you want to go on holiday to the English countryside by mistake, download Richard E. Grant’s cult comedy.

BOOKS

SHANTARAM For a wild ride through India and beyond, read Gregory David Roberts’ cult novel, which has also been turned into a TV series starring Charlie Hunnam.

MEMOIRS OF A GEISHA That world might be gone, but Arthur Golden’s smash-hit novel will transport you to a Japan of cherry blossom and tea ceremonies.

DOWN UNDER and NOTES FROM A SMALL ISLAND Bill Bryson’s funny and endearing travel guides to Australia and the UK make you feel as if you were on the road with him.

EAT PRAY LOVE Run away from it all, with Elizabeth Gilbert’s popular self-discovery account of her journey to Italy, India and Bali.

THE BEACH Aside from all the bloodshed, Alex Garland’s thriller set in Thailand — and movie with Leonardo DiCaprio — will get you longing for the blue waters of Koh Phi Phi.

OUT OF AFRICA You’ll be wishing you had a farm in Africa too in Karen Blixen’s memoir and haunting movie starring Meryl Streep.

THE DA VINCI CODE Dan Brown’s blockbuster takes you on a breakneck journey from France to Britain, faster than a Contiki tour. If you fancy more, follow-up with Angels and Demons for Rome and Inferno for Florence and Venice.

BRIDESHEAD REVISITED Before Downton Abbey, there was Evelyn Waugh’s Brideshead Revisited, which transports you into an enchanting pre-war England. The 1981 TV series is still the best.

PODCASTS

WILD IDEAS WORTH LIVING Listen to people who had a wild idea and made it happen, with Shelby Stranger.

THE TRAVEL DIARIES Go along for the ride with Holly Rubenstein as she chats to guests about their travel experiences.

WOMEN WHO TRAVEL Immerse yourself in all things travel with the editors of Conde Nast Traveller.

WANDER WOMAN Head off the beaten track with Phoebe Smith.

THE TRAIL LESS TRAVELLED Visit remote locations and get to know the locals with Mandela van Eeden.

TV SHOWS

THE DURRELLS Feel the heat of Corfu in this series around the true story of Lawrence and Gerald Durrell’s family’s adventures.

KILLING EVE Aside from all the blood, this hit series still makes you want to go to Paris.

THE TRIP Take a gourmet tour of the UK, Italy, Spain and Greece with funny men Steve Coogan and Rob Brydon.

TRAVEL MAN Laugh a lot with British comedian Richard Ayoade’s mini-city-guides.

OZARK Get lost in the remote American Ozarks with Jason Bateman in this thriller series.

AN IDIOT ABROADFor a guide on how not to travel, tune in to Ricky Gervais’ sidekick Karl Pilkington’s entertaining alternative series.

OUTLANDERTake a wild and thrilling journey to the Scottish Highlands in this hit TV series.

LONG WAY ROUND Rev up with Ewan McGregor and mate Charley Boorman as they ride their motorbikes from London to New York, then later Cape Town, in these epic travelogues.

ANTHONY BOURDAIN: PARTS UNKNOWNIt’s still a pleasure to lose yourself in Anthony Bourdain’s travel shows.

AUDIOBOOKS

A WALK IN THE WOODS, narrated by Bill Bryson Accompany the author on his hilarious hike along America’s Appalachian Trail.

WILD, narrated by Bernadette Dunne Similarly, take a journey of self-discovery with Cheryl Strayed on the US’s Pacific Crest Trail.

THE MAGUS, narrated by Charles Dance Get lost in John Fowles’ magical novel set on the Greek island of Phraxos, brought to life by the cast of the BBC Radio production.

LORD OF THE RINGS, narrated by Rob Inglis Admittedly, Middle Earth isn’t real, but you can take the ultimate journey with J.R.R. Tolkien.

ALL THE LIGHT WE CANNOT SEE, narrated by Julie Teal Go from Paris to Saint-Malo in World War II with Anthony Doerr’s Pulitzer winner.

THE NARROW ROAD TO THE DEEP NORTH, narrated by Richard Flanagan Then go from Tasmania and South Australia to the Burma death railway of WWII as the Australian author reads his Booker Prize-winning novel.
